Calcium Chloride Flake
Product Specification

General Description

Calcium Chloride 77-80%, is a flaked calcium chloride dihydrate product.

Applications

Calcium Chloride 77-80% is primarily used for dust control of unpaved roads and parking lots, and as a deicer. Industrial applications include concrete acceleration, tire weighting, brine refrigeration systems, waste water treatment, and as a calcium source for chemical processing.

Many applications of Calcium Chloride require the material to be put into solution.

Chemical Properties

Item

Limit

Calcium Chloride, min.
77.0%
Total Alkali Salts (as NaCl), max.
4.3%
Total Magnesium (as MgCl2), max.
0.07%
Other Impurities, max.
0.85%
Calcium Hydroxide, max.
0.10%
Calcium Carbonate, max.
0.07%
Sulfate (as SO4), max.
0.04%
Iron (as Fe), max.
0.005%
Heavy Metals (as Pb), max.
0.002%
